Nutrition: The Unsung Hero
A recurring theme among commenters was the significant impact of nutrition on achieving a toned physique. User roofbandit stated, “Toned physique is mostly made in the kitchen,” emphasizing that exercise is only part of the equation. Various comments echoed this sentiment, reinforcing the idea that caloric intake and the quality of food are paramount in complementing physical efforts. For a well-rounded fitness approach, maintaining a calorie deficit while balancing nutrients becomes the cornerstone of not only weight loss but also muscle definition and retention.

A Balanced Approach
<pFor many participants, achieving a toned look is not solely about increasing yoga frequency but rather integrating various physical activities into a balanced routine. Chazinmidtown shared a relatable perspective by saying, "…I don’t think it's enough esp if you live in a car-focused city," indicating that lifestyle factors also influence workout effectiveness. The ideal combination seemingly includes weight training and cardio, alongside consistent yoga practice to not just build tones but also to develop better strength and flexibility. This balance ensures holistic fitness—achieving the desired aesthetics while fostering overall well-being.
